- What does FMPCX invest in?
- Typically, this fund allocates a minimum of 80% of its total investable capital—including both its net assets and any borrowed funds—to common equities issued by small-capitalization companies. These smaller firms are specifically identified as those with market valuations aligning with the range of companies comprising the Russell 2000® Index, a range established on the final business day of the month following the index's most recent rebalancing event.
